Exhaustion Over Enjoyment
In the world of gaming, striking the right balance between enjoyment and repetitive tasks can be tricky. It appears that the fishing mechanic in Abiotic Factor might be pushing too far towards tedious monotony for some players. User nliukz succinctly captured this feeling, describing it as “exhausting, time-consuming, and dull.” The issue seems to lie in the perceived lack of difficulty within the minigame, which in turn leads to a cycle of disengagement. Player YRUSoCruel echoed similar sentiments, suggesting that if the game were more challenging, it might be less monotonous. Instead, players find themselves repeating the same actions, leading to feelings of boredom and lack of enthusiasm.
Players express frustration about frequently getting stuck in a loop, similar to nliukz who says that even with advanced equipment, the excitement of catching rare fish becomes as dull as watching paint dry. It’s almost like a form of punishment, especially after numerous unsuccessful attempts resulting in mediocre catches. Remarks such as those from vengeur50 showcase the significant irritation experienced when players are forced to endure long mini-games without any guarantee of a reward.
Suggestions for Improvements
Players aren’t passively watching and tolerating the dull fishing mechanics in the game; instead, they’re yearning for something new! Many ideas have surfaced, showcasing players’ strong desire to enhance their fishing adventure. Some players, such as 0-GLaDOS-0, suggest innovative gameplay adjustments, like a charm that reveals the type of fish on the hook. “It would be great to bypass the uninteresting fish,” they say. This idea calls for a fresh take on the fishing experience, offering players not just the catch but an exhilarating pre-catch experience.
Some users, such as vengeur50, propose tailoring the length of the minigame according to a player’s fishing skill level. This means that for expert anglers, the minigame could play out in just a few seconds. By quickening the pace of the game to suit an experienced player’s abilities, it could create more excitement and transform what was once considered a tedious task into a thrilling challenge.
After that, there’s a suggestion for adding extras or rewards that could provide extra benefits with rare catches. By introducing special fishing equipment such as sonar potions from Terraria, players can enjoy the excitement of the hunt while avoiding catching too many similar fish, making the experience more engaging and rewarding instead of monotonous!
Macros and Automation: A Cop-Out or a Lifesaver?
In difficult situations, certain players opt for innovative workarounds like creating macros for automated fishing. The original poster, nliukz, subtly suggested this idea. Although there’s often a question of ethics regarding employing mods or automation, particularly in competitive games, some individuals can’t help but wonder if it’s acceptable. It’s a balancing act between preserving the game’s honesty and ensuring personal mental well-being.
User Repulsive_Pepper_957 passionately advocated for a speedy fishing mod that bypasses the mini-game, offering an instant catch experience instead. While some may contend this diminishes the game’s intent, others are adamant that automation is merely a tool to elevate enjoyment. After all, if the task becomes monotonous, isn’t it reasonable to seek alternatives that enable players to advance without the tedium?
